74% of Consumers Use Mobile Ads to Discover New Apps According to ironSource Report

Mobile Ads to Discover New Apps
ironSource (NYSE: IS), a leading business platform for the App Economy, today presents its MobileVoice® reports: The Modern Mobile Consumer 2022: App Discovery and Monetization. The reports, available in two versions — one for app marketers and one for monetization managers — provide data around the app discovery habits of consumers, and dive into which types of ads are preferred, how often they use their downloaded apps, why they use their apps and more. ironSource’s data also reveals how attitudes towards advertising and monetization have evolved, as well as highlighting the differences in the ways that Generation X, Millennials, and Generation Z engage with mobile apps.

The reports are the latest in Tapjoy’s Modern Mobile Gamer® series, which focuses on consumers’ understanding of the freemium app ecosystem and dives into who plays mobile games and why. Modern Mobile Consumer builds on that foundation by analyzing how people use their smartphones, as well as their evolving feelings about mobile ads and monetization. It is the eleventh report in the series since its creation in 2017.

Leveraging MobileVoice®, ironSources' market research solution, insights were collected from 30,457 consumers through opt-in surveys across thousands of mobile apps within MobileVoice®, as well as 500 additional respondents from a control group used to eliminate bias and confirm accuracy.

Here are some of the key findings:
  • Mobile ads drive app discovery. 74% of consumers (averaged across both groups) downloaded apps after viewing mobile ads for them.
  • Gaming maintains its popularity vis-a-vis social media. Among the audience surveyed in apps outside of games, 60% play mobile games, tying with social media for most-used type of apps.
  • Rewarded ads have expanded beyond mobile games. 33% of consumers surveyed in apps outside of games say they pay more attention to ads with in-app rewards. This is only slightly less than the gaming-focused group, indicating that consumers are broadly receptive to the rewarded model.
  • Consumers use a small number of the apps they download. The majority of mobile users have 20 or more apps on their devices, but up to 50% only use 5-10 on a daily basis. That’s why it’s critical for publishers and developers to focus on retention as well as acquisition.
  • Relaxation leads to higher downloads. People are most likely to download new apps while on vacation or in their free time.
  • Entertainment and relaxation are the primary app use cases. 65% of consumers repeatedly use their apps for entertainment and relaxation.
  • Diversified app monetization strategies are essential. While around a third of all surveyed groups said they never pay to download apps, between 28% and 49% occasionally make in-app purchases of a few dollars at a time. Attitudes towards monetization outside of mobile games are changing, with 15% of the non-gaming-app audience reporting that they make more in-app purchases than they did five years ago.

ironSource’s Modern Mobile Consumer 2022 reports utilized MobileVoice® market research data gathered from a variety of popular apps via the Tapjoy Offerwall. Additional responses were curated by third-party polling service Pollfish to confirm accuracy and eliminate possible bias. All respondents confirmed that they were 18 years or older, and responses were filtered to provide the most accurate data.

Jasper Expands by Acquiring Image Platform Clipdrop from Stability AI

PR Newswire | February 23, 2024

Jasper, one of the world's biggest generative AI app companies, has announced that it has reached an agreement to acquire Clipdrop, an AI image creation and editing platform, from Stability AI. This acquisition signifies a significant step forward in Jasper's capacity to deliver the most comprehensive, multimodal copilot for enterprise marketing teams. Clipdrop is an image creation and editing platform used by millions of creative designers and brands worldwide. Founded in 2020 by Google alumni Cyril Diagne, Damien Henry, and Jonathan Blanchet, Clipdrop enables users to edit existing images, create new ones, and develop an expansive number of variations in size, detail, and style. For marketers and brand leaders, this technology can be a catalyst for accelerating their ad strategies and developing on-brand creative. "Marketing is visual," said Timothy Young, CEO of Jasper. "The addition of Clipdrop to Jasper will advance our vision to be the most comprehensive end-to-end marketing copilot in the industry, powering all the formats, channels, and functions enterprise marketing teams need. A copilot this robust will enable the enterprises we serve to go beyond simple AI prompts to achieve more personalized marketing, better informed automation, and improved optimization across their entire strategy." The Clipdrop team will join Jasper effective immediately and continue to lead research and innovation on multimodality in Jasper from their headquarters in Paris, which has become a hub of AI innovation in Europe. With this acquisition, Jasper expands its footprint to Europe and plans to continue to invest there from both a talent and customer acquisition standpoint. The company is eager to contribute to Paris's vibrant AI community. "Jasper has been a valued partner, leveraging Stability AI models for many years," said Emad Mostaque, CEO of Stability AI. "We're thrilled to see Clipdrop expand their offering by joining forces with Jasper. We will continue to partner with Clipdrop on research and deliver our cutting-edge models to their platform." "We are excited about what Clipdrop technology can do inside Jasper's copilot for marketing teams," said Damien Henry, Clipdrop co-founder. "There are natural synergies between the two companies and a clear focus on creating the best multimodal platform for marketers. We can't wait to get started." In addition to leading further development of AI-assisted image creation and editing, Damien Henry will play a larger leadership role in research and innovation for the entire Jasper product. The acquisition of Clipdrop closed on February 20, 2024. Business customers will be able to access it through the Jasper API immediately, over time the functionality will be more deeply integrated into the copilot. Force Management Expands its Ascender Sales Acceleration Platform with Content and Curriculum for Revenue Teams

Business Wire | January 25, 2024

Force Management, provider of elite sales solutions, announced today the launch of Ascender® Plus, a significant expansion of the Ascender sales acceleration platform and community. The Ascender sales acceleration platform reinforces Force Management’s consulting and training services with content and curriculum that drive desired sales practices and improve execution for revenue teams. Teams using Force Management’s core methodologies can now leverage Ascender Plus to support team engagement, accelerate adoption, and drive long-term consistency and results. “Ascender provides our clients with a powerful tool to improve revenue team execution and foster a culture of continuous, consistent professional growth,” says Grant Wilson, CEO of Force Management. “Ascender now accelerates adoption of our Command Series offerings by providing customer-facing revenue teams, managers, and executives with 24-7 access to content, tools, and resources that support their engagement with Force Management and successful execution of sales methodologies.” Ascender subscribers can access content and curriculum on-demand in a variety of learning formats that are easily consumable by busy revenue teams. New content is published daily and designed to keep sales best practices top-of-mind. Ascender users also benefit from an active digital community of their peers, with live events and online learning opportunities led by Force Management SMEs and other industry professionals. “The way people learn and retain information is enhanced through modern delivery techniques such as digital learning, personalized curricula, and regular assessment and coaching,” says Paul Giaconia, Force Management Chief Product Officer. “Today’s revenue teams are looking for learning experiences that engage them in the ways they learn best. The Ascender platform includes on-demand access to video, podcast, and eLearning formats as well as a community of like-minded experts that help revenue teams advance their professional development and boost revenue performance.” The platform provides customized content to support Force Management’s methodology-based engagements such as Command of the Message® and the MEDDICC sales qualification approach.
